Job Description

Responsibilities:

The Operations Analyst is an individual contributor and is responsible for ensuring that the school is able to run smoothly so that students and other staff members have a great learning environment. The Operations Analyst will be responsible for the following: Ensuring compliance with all ISSPS, Springfield, state, and federal requirements Managing the school's physical plant Coordinating with SPS personnel regarding any physical plant challenges/problems Overseeing transportation, food services, health, and safety Managing technology in the building Leading event logistics (for assemblies, field trips, etc.) Coordinating visitor procedures Working closely with ISSPS, SPS, and others to ensure effective communication and timely completion of all logistical matters Building and fostering positive relationships with family members and the community Serving as a representative of the school to the community; working with staff members to insure that families are well-informed about what is happening in school and have other opportunities to interact positively with the school Supervise public areas (such as hallways and other public spaces) when appropriate to reinforce school behavior expectations Other tasks as assigned by supervisor.This position requires autonomy for decision making and independent judgment.

Qualifications: A Bachelor's degree is preferred, or can be substituted for five years of experience. At least 2-3 years of experience in field is required. Basic computer skills with applications such as MS Word, MS Excel etc. Must be skilled with navigating technology innovations and support and enhance the technology integration of the Executive Principal and team

About our District

Springfield Public Schools is a cultural gem in Western Massachusetts that is committed to providing a learning environment that opens the doors of infinite possibilities to our amazing students and staff. We strive to equip each of our approximately 24,000 students with learning experiences that enhance their knowledge and critical thinking skills. We are the 3rd largest district in Massachusetts. Our district has over 44 languages spoken and over 60 countries represented by both students and staff.
